匿名用户只可下载.在upload目录可上传.管理员帐号可以管理/与/upload.
ftpuser建立admin帐号记录.
vsftpd_user_conf/admin
local_root=/var/ftp #将admin的主目录设到匿名帐号的主目录
anon_world_readable_only=NO #开放匿名用户访问
anon_upload_enable=YES #开放上传权限
anon_mkdir_write_enable=YES #开放创建目录权限
anon_other_write_enable=YES #匿名用户可以删除文件.
修改目录权限
chown virtual /var/ftp
chown virtual /var/ftp/upload
chmod 0666 /var/ftp/upload
#####
禁止某些用户登录FTP
userlist_enable=YES
userlist_deny=YES
userlist_file=/usr/local/etc/vsftpd.user_list
ee /usr/local/etc/vsftpd.user_list
加入要禁止登录FTP的用户名,如
ftp
root
####
max_clients=200
max_per_ip=4